Makes me laugh that the seller thinks the car is so awesome and special because it's the "last one" and asks for a $20k market adjustment when in reality the 2013's with the V8's are more desirable still. My LR4 is a late 2013 also with the highly desirable HD pkg* and I know I would take better pictures than that guy. At least I'd dry the car and dress the tires.
*The HD pkg is rare on any type of LR4, but starting with the V6 in 2014, the transfer case was yanked and only included with the HD pkg option. So while rare, some people realized they wanted at least the T-case and ordered the HD pkg. On V8 models, because they all already came with the T-case, the HD pkg was extremely rare because it only added the e-locking diff and full-size spare and nearly no one ordered it for stock and very few ordered it for custom orders. It was smoking deal though: For $750 you got a full alloy wheel and tire and the e-diff which basically cannot be retrofitted and costs thousands by itself.
